Web26 Sep 2024 · Sebaceous glands are attached to hair follicles all over your body. They release sebum onto your skin’s surface. The primary bronchi enter the lungs at the hilum. Web18 Jul 2024 · Sebaceous glands (SGs) originate from hair follicular stem cells and secrete lipids to lubricate the skin. The coordinated effects of intrinsic and extrinsic aging factors generate degradation of SGs at a late age. Senescence of SGs could be a mirror of the late aging of both the human body and skin.
